CHEESY FRENCH TOAST
Steps:
- Preheat your oven to 200 degrees F (95 degrees C) and place a baking sheet on the middle rack.
- Place a large nonstick skillet over medium heat.
- Whisk the eggs, milk, salt, pepper and nutmeg together in a shallow bowl or pie plate. Place two pieces of bread into the custard mixture and allow them to soak for about 30 seconds on each side.
- Add 2 teaspoons of butter and 1 teaspoon of oil to the pan and swirl to combine. Add in four slices of custard-soaked bread and cook for 3 to 4 minutes per side, or until golden brown. Transfer to the oven to keep warm. Soak the remaining bread and cook the French toast in the remaining butter and oil.
- In the same skillet, cook the pancetta over medium heat, if using, until crisp, flipping as needed, about 4 minutes.
- Remove the French toast from the oven and sprinkle each piece with about 1/4 cup of grated cheese. Return to the oven, turn the broiler on to high and broil until the cheese is melted and lightly golden brown, about 1 to 2 minutes.
- Top each piece with a couple of pieces of crispy pancetta, if using, and serve two slices of French toast per person, drizzled with maple syrup.
SUMMERY CHEESE ON TOAST
Perfect for a cheeky late supper
Provided by Good Food team
Categories Lunch, Main course, Snack, Supper
Time 15m
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Heat the grill to high. Toast the bread on one side. Flip the slices over and top each with a slice of tomato, goat's cheese and basil leaf. Drizzle a little oil over each one. Grill for about 5 mins until the cheese is just starting to melt and the basil leaf is crispy.

CHEESE ON TOAST
Provided by Alex Guarnaschelli
Categories appetizer
Time 30m
Yield 16 toasts
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- The thing I like most about a recipe like this is that you have a chance to showcase your favorite type of cheese in a way that's hard for people to resist. I like goat cheese for the "tang" factor and the supple texture. This goes great with a bowl of my chicken soup but can really fit in with any soup for the "comfort" factor.
- Heat a large skillet over medium heat and add the olive oil. When the oil begins to smoke lightly, shut off the heat and add the thyme leaves. The thyme should make a crackling sound as it hits the oil, cooking it slightly and mellowing the flavor. Add the bread in a single layer. Turn the heat back on and cook over medium heat until the first side browns, 2 to 3 minutes.
- Use a pair of tongs to turn the toasts on their second side and season with kosher salt. Top each round with a slice of cheese and continue cooking them over very low heat or off the heat, an additional 2 to 3 minutes. Adjust the seasonings with sea salt, to taste. Serve alone or alongside soup, if desired.
FRESH TOMATO SOUP WITH CRISPY CHEESE TOAST
We're doing a very fresh twist on the classic cream of tomato soup with a grilled cheese sandwich. Since we're using fresh tomatoes at their peak of vine-ripened goodness, this simple soup is going to be not quite, but almost, 100% tomato.
Provided by Chef John
Categories Soups, Stews and Chili Recipes Soup Recipes Vegetable Soup Recipes Tomato Soup Recipes
Time 1h10m
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Remove cores from tomatoes and cut in half crosswise. Reserve until needed.
- Heat olive oil and butter in a saucepan over medium-high heat. Add garlic and anchovy and cook until garlic is sizzling in the hot fat, 45 seconds to 1 minute. Carefully add the tomatoes with their juices, salt, and red pepper flakes. Toss with a spoon every few minutes until the tomatoes release their liquid and start to break down.
- Once the tomatoes have softened and start to collapse, reduce heat to medium-low and cook, stirring occasionally, until the tomatoes have fallen apart and the soup resembles a coarse tomato sauce, about 45 minutes.
- Meanwhile, preheat the oven to 450 degrees F (230 degrees C). Line a baking sheet with foil or a silicone liner. Drizzle with 2 tablespoons olive oil.
- Place the bread slices on the prepared baking sheet. Top each slice with sliced basil, and then Cheddar cheese.
- Bake in the preheated oven until the cheese is well browned and crispy around the edges, 15 to 20 minutes. Let cool to room temperature.
- Remove soup from heat and pass through a mesh strainer into a bowl. Use the back of a ladle to push all the tomato mixture through. Discard the skins and seeds, which should be the only things left in the strainer.
- Transfer the strained tomato soup back into the saucepan and place back over medium-low heat. Continue cooking to thicken slightly, if desired, or simply bring back to a simmer and serve immediately with the cheese toasts.

CHEESY TEXAS TOAST
My husband and I love garlic bread, but it's such a waste for just the two of us, so I came up with this cheesy Texas toast recipe. You can prepare it in a few minutes, and it's tasty, too! -LaDonna Reed, Ponca City, Oklahoma
Provided by Taste of Home
Time 15m
Yield 2 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Spread butter over bread. Sprinkle with garlic powder and cheese. Place on an ungreased baking sheet. , Bake at 400° for 5-7 minutes or until cheese is melted. Sprinkle with onions or parsley if desired. Serve warm.

CHEESY EGGS ON TOAST
You don't even need a toaster to make perfect toast. Crisping bread in a skillet - in melted butter, of course - gives it a tasty brown crunch and leaves you with a hot pan ready to scramble eggs. Be sure to swipe up all the butter and crumbs with the toasted bread when you take it out to keep the eggs nice and golden. Because more butter is added to the pan at the same time as the eggs, it melts slowly into the eggs while you stir them, leaving you with a creamy mix that ends up even creamier when cheese is melted in at the very end.
Provided by Genevieve Ko
Categories breakfast, brunch, easy
Time 10m
Yield 1 serving
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Crack the eggs into a bowl and sprinkle generously with salt and pepper. Beat with a fork until evenly yellow. Leave the bowl next to the stove while you make the toast.
- In a small nonstick skillet, melt a thin slice of the butter over medium-low heat. Swipe the bread in the melted butter to soak it all up. Let sit until golden brown, 2 to 3 minutes. Add another thin slice of butter to the pan then flip the bread, swiping it in the newly melted butter until it's all soaked up. Turn the heat to the lowest setting and let the bread sit until lightly browned, 1 to 2 minutes. Transfer to a plate.
- Add the remaining butter and the eggs and cook, stirring gently and constantly with a wooden spoon, until the butter melts and the eggs are half wet and half solid, 15 to 45 seconds. Turn off the heat, add the cheese and continue stirring until the mixture is creamy but no longer wet, about 30 to 45 seconds. Scrape onto the toast right away and enjoy.
